Key Parameter Overview
Decoding the Specs for Enhanced Industrial Reliability
The following table outlines the critical technical specifications for the P1010WXF1MB10. These values are essential for calculating power budgets and enclosure ventilation requirements.
| Technical Attribute | Specification Value | Engineering Significance |
|---|---|---|
| Screen Size | 10.1-inch | Ideal for compact PLC control panels. |
| Resolution | 1280(RGB) x 800 (WXGA) | High pixel density for complex waveforms. |
| Luminance | 400 cd/m² (Typ.) | Ensures visibility in indoor factory lighting. |
| Interface Type | LVDS (1 ch, 8-bit) | Industry-standard for low noise and high speed. |
| Contrast Ratio | 800:1 (Typ.) | Deep blacks and sharp text rendering. |
| Operating Temperature | -20 ~ 70 °C | Maintains liquid crystal stability in harsh zones. |
| Backlight Type | WLED | Long life-cycle and reduced power consumption. |

Technical Deep Dive
A Closer Look at Signal Integrity and Backlight Efficiency
From an engineering perspective, the LVDS (Low-Voltage Differential Signaling) implementation in the P1010WXF1MB10 is its most vital feature. Think of LVDS as a dual-lane high-speed bridge where cars (data) travel in opposite directions at once; the resulting balanced current cancels out radiation that could interfere with sensitive PLC sensors. This is a critical advantage when designing TFT-LCD systems for modern industrial automation.

Frequently Asked Questions
What is the primary benefit of the P1010WXF1MB10's LVDS interface in industrial designs?
The LVDS interface provides high-speed data transmission with extremely low power consumption and high noise immunity, making it ideal for environments with heavy electromagnetic interference from motors and actuators.
How does the 800:1 contrast ratio impact user interface design for field technicians?
An 800:1 contrast ratio ensures that text and icons are clearly distinguishable even in high-glare environments. This reduces eye strain for operators and minimizes the risk of input errors during critical machine adjustments.
Can the P1010WXF1MB10 be used in outdoor kiosks?
While its 400 cd/m² brightness is suitable for shaded outdoor areas, full sunlight applications may require an additional high-brightness film or specialized housing. However, its -20 to 70 °C operating range makes it robust enough for the thermal swings associated with outdoor enclosures.
